In its earlier days, CarroPX was a Spanish language only program, but that ends today! Now all you English speakers can get in on the fun. In this pixelated car game the object is simple: avoid other objects at all costs. At the start of each session you'll be asked to pick the difficulty level and speed at which you would like to travel. Then it is up to you to set and beat your own records through your score. Changelog
Added language English.
Added new sounds.
Several bug fixes.
Language English and Spanish.
10 levels and 10 speeds each.
3 attempts / lives.
Sub Menu with Levels and Speed coach.
Record Aautoguardado the highest degree obtained.
Record Re-iniciador/borrador.
Displays the current Record and Record higher.
Displays the time from the beginning of the level.
Menu
Digital Pad: We will move through the options.
X: We enter the selected option.
O: We return to the menu after entering an option.
Game
Digital Pad: will control the car.
X: Expedite.
Start: Pause / Menu
